Transaction 874dd10a43ef3deee071476fbaee423672836087fe15215c4715b1b6ba3819bb
3 Input
1 Outputs
- 874dd10a43ef3deee071476fbaee423672836087fe15215c4715b1b6ba3819bb:0
value 517634
address bc1qxx0vw2mhn09mjw0an4dkum5ju0pt84n6t96e7l